The Bank for International Settlements (BIS) is an international financial institution which is owned by member central banks.[2] Its primary goal is to foster international monetary and financial cooperation while serving as a bank for central banks.[3] With its establishment in 1930 it is the oldest international financial institution.[4][5] Its initial purpose was to oversee the settlement of World War I war reparations.
